Here is a fun rhythm I have used several times on my upcoming album Heptology. It is performed on a Buchla 200e. We start with a 7/8 rhythm. A 3-2 polyrhythm is overlaid. The faster "three" of this rhythm contains two notes, and the slower "two" of this rhythm has three notes. This results in a rhythm which repeats every 18 1/8th notes. It can also be thought of as a 18-12 polyrhythm. I got the idea for this rhythm from here: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dp2kwhJokNU A just intonation scale is used: 1/1, 7/6, 4/3, 7/5, 3/2, 14/9, 7/4. This is a very consonant scale, with many internal consonant intervals. 7/6 is consonant with both 3/2 and 14/9. This is also true for 4/3. The interval between 3/2 and 14/9 is only 63 cents, which is very close to a quartertone. It is thus a good scale to incorporate a quartertone and be generally consonant.
